Leviticus 15:5

KJV

And whosoever toucheth his bed shall wash his clothes, and bathe himself in water, and be unclean until the even.

— Leviticus 15:5, King James Version

他の翻訳

ASV

And whosoever toucheth his bed shall wash his clothes, and bathe himself in water, and be unclean until the even.

YLT

and any one who cometh against his bed doth wash his garments, and hath bathed with water, and been unclean till the evening.

BBE

And anyone touching his bed is to have his clothing washed and his body bathed in water and be unclean till evening.
